PODCAST | Angelo Acerbi interviews Hazel Honeysuckle and Gal Friday, actresses of the film Getting Naked: A Burlesque Story.
During an entertaining photo shoot, we talked with two of the ladies portrayed in Getting Naked :A Burlesque Story, to understand more about this art of performance. From two goddesses of burlesque, we get inside information, inquiring on the choice of the name, the many different kinds of existing burlesque performances and the reason why they were attracted to it in the first place.
Getting Naked: A Burlesque Story peels back the curtain to reveal the sexy sub-culture of the neo- burlesque scene in New York City. This vérité documentary intimately follows four performers, each of whom has discovered a newfound identity and belonging in a world of bawdy comedy and striptease. However, they find that all that glitters is not necessarily gold, as this liberating community does not insulate from the harsh realities of sexism, illness and existential crisis. Getting Naked explores what it means to be an artist, an entertainer, and a woman in the toughest city on Earth..
